Output 8f73fb6a009464e32c415f94b8e6617ba5985ca8232c7a2404334cd94b4376d9:45

value
64997648
script pubkey
OP_0 OP_PUSHBYTES_20 c2c30badc5ecfd091853f61a5cdd0b38461eca65
address
bc1qctpshtw9an7sjxzn7cd9ehgt8prpajn9hk8lsk
transaction
8f73fb6a009464e32c415f94b8e6617ba5985ca8232c7a2404334cd94b4376d9
spent
true